Black Stallion Writing Contest #2: Participate!

Writing Contest Rules:

Submissions are accepted from February 23 – March 1, 2008

1. It can be any kind of writing (poetry, short story, chapter from a novel, screenplay, play, anything written), but It MUST be your original writing.
2. It can be as short as you want, but limit it to a maximum of 10 pages (2,500 words).
3. You can submit as many different ‘stories’ as you want… but each piece MUST have something to do with horses.
3. There are 4 different age group categories:
Grade school, Middle school, High school, and Adult
4. The contest will run for one month, but the winner’s stories will be posted longer in the Reading Room.
5. Everyone gets only ONE vote in each of the 4 age group categories. There will be a voting page for you to vote March 1 through March 10. It’s the honor system…. YOU ARE THE JUDGES!!!!!
6. Post your stories HERE, on this thread on the forum.

This isn’t a school assignment … just for fun … I’ve heard lot of good horse stories … and some of them were even true!! I’m sure you know some too.

There will be eight winners, 2 from each group ….
